Product Overview

Category

The SMCJ6042E3/TR13 belongs to the category of transient voltage suppressor diodes.

Use

It is used to protect sensitive electronic devices from voltage spikes and transients.

Characteristics

  • Fast response time
  • Low clamping voltage
  • High surge current capability

Package

The SMCJ6042E3/TR13 is available in a DO-214AB (SMC) package.

Essence

The essence of this product lies in its ability to quickly divert excessive voltage away from sensitive components, thereby safeguarding them from damage.

Packaging/Quantity

The SMCJ6042E3/TR13 is typically packaged in reels with a quantity of 1500 units per reel.

Specifications

  • Standoff Voltage: 51.7V
  • Breakdown Voltage: 57.2V
  • Maximum Clamping Voltage: 82.4V
  • Peak Pulse Current: 30.5A
  • Operating Temperature Range: -55°C to 150°C

Detailed Pin Configuration

The SMCJ6042E3/TR13 has two pins, with the anode connected to the positive side and the cathode connected to the negative side.

Functional Features

  • Transient voltage suppression
  • Reverse avalanche capability
  • Low leakage current

Advantages

  • Provides effective protection against voltage surges
  • Fast response time ensures minimal impact on the protected circuit
  • Wide operating temperature range allows for versatile application

Disadvantages

  • May exhibit some capacitance, affecting high-frequency performance
  • Clamping voltage may still be relatively high for some sensitive components

Working Principles

When a voltage surge occurs, the SMCJ6042E3/TR13 conducts and diverts the excess energy to the ground, limiting the voltage across the protected circuit.

Detailed Application Field Plans

The SMCJ6042E3/TR13 is commonly used in: - Power supplies - Telecommunication equipment - Automotive electronics - Industrial control systems
